OCTAVIAN. Denarius (30-29 BC). Uncertain mint in Italy, possibly Rome.
Obv : Laureate head of Apollo of Actium right, with features of Octavian.
Rev : IMP CAESAR.
Octavian, as city founder, plowing right with yoke of oxen, holding whip and plow handle.
RIC II 272; CRI 424.
